Engine Technician Job Description As an Engine Technician, you will collaborate with engineers in a state-of-the-art propulsion laboratory to develop, calibrate, and test engine components. You will work on cutting-edge projects that could be years away from production, contributing to the development and validation of high-performance engines. Responsibilities Work closely with engineers to conduct calibration development, mechanical experiments, and manual test points for engine development. Perform mechanical swapping of engine components to optimize performance. Utilize AVL/PUMA and emissions equipment in a laboratory setting. Execute engine tuning and calibration using HP Tuners or standalone systems. Run and operate manual testing on a dynamometer. Collaborate with Test Engineers to adjust fuel tables, air intake, spark, and exhaust for optimal performance. Work at the component level, including tasks such as oil pumps, head or cam changes, fuel injectors, and spark plugs. Assemble, modify, and fabricate engines for testing. Fabricate components for engine and test stand/dynos. Perform instrumentation between the engine and the dyno. TIG weld parts and components as needed. Essential Skills 3-5 years of experience with engine dynamometers. Hands-on experience with engine rebuild, tear down, assembly, repair, and troubleshooting. Proficiency in fabrication and assembly using hand tools. Associate's degree in a relevant field. Additional Skills & Qualifications Experience with AVL/PUMA and emissions equipment. Familiarity with engine tuning software such as HP Tuners. Experience in a laboratory setting focused on testing and development. Calibration experience, ideally gained from personal projects or work with standalone fueling systems.
